核心要点:
- Excel中的
#NAME?错误是商务用户常见但影响工作的难题,通常由拼写错误、遗漏语法或版本不兼容导致,会中断关键分析流程。 - 匡优Excel通过让用户用自然语言描述目标,从根本上消除了此类错误,完全无需编写和调试复杂公式。
- 对非技术专业人士而言,这种AI驱动的方法能即时生成无差错结果,将时间专注于洞察与决策而非技术排错。
- 采用匡优Excel等工具标志着战略转变:从纠缠软件机制转向快速自信地达成业务成果。
你是否曾在Excel中精心输入公式,却只得到令人沮丧的#NAME?错误?这个提示意味着Excel无法识别你输入的内容。可能是细微的拼写错误、遗漏的命名区域,或是Excel无法理解的函数语法。无论原因如何,这种问题足以让你的数据分析陷入停滞。
本指南将探讨#NAME?错误的常见成因,并逐步演示传统修复方法。我们还将介绍一种现代化的AI驱动方案,帮助您彻底规避这类公式错误,节省时间精力。
什么是Excel中的#NAME?错误?
当Excel遇到公式中无法解析的内容时,就会显示#NAME?错误。公式遵循严格语法规则,每个元素——无论是函数名称、命名区域还是文本字符串——都必须是Excel可识别的。当某个组件未定义、拼写错误或格式不规范时,Excel就会抛出#NAME?错误。这不是可忽略的普通警告,而是公式部分内容在Excel语言体系中无法解析的信号。
#NAME?错误的常见成因
让我们通过对比手动修复与AI解决方案,了解电子表格中出现#NAME?错误的原因。
函数名拼写错误
最常见原因是简单的拼写错误。一个字母错误就可能导致公式失效。例如将正确的COUNTIF()误写为CONTIF(),Excel将无法识别并返回#NAME?错误。

AI驱动替代方案
无需记忆和输入函数名称,匡优Excel等AI工具允许您用自然语言指令陈述目标。您只需上传文件并询问"统计C列中为'通过'的单元格数量"。匡优Excel会解读您的需求并直接给出答案,完全绕过编写公式的环节,杜绝拼写错误风险。
旧版Excel使用新函数
有时错误源于使用了仅适用于新版Excel(如Excel 365)的函数。例如FILTER()、XLOOKUP()和UNIQUE()在Excel 2019或更早版本中无效,会导致#NAME?错误。
注意:可通过文件 > 账户 > 关于Excel查看版本信息。

AI驱动替代方案
使用AI工具可消除版本兼容性问题。匡优Excel在持续更新的统一环境中运行。您可以要求执行通常需要XLOOKUP()或FILTER()的任务,无论电脑安装何种Excel版本,它都能完美执行。
无效或拼写错误的命名区域
命名区域是为单元格组定义的自定义名称。如果名称拼写错误或命名区域已被删除,Excel会显示#NAME?错误。
注意:通过公式选项卡打开名称管理器,可确认区域名称及其作用范围(工作表局部或工作簿全局)。

AI驱动替代方案
使用匡优Excel无需担心命名区域的精确语法。您可以用更自然的方式引用数据,例如"计算'Sales2024'表格的总利润"。AI通过上传文件理解上下文,无需完美管理或输入命名区域即可找到正确数据。
错误的区域引用
Excel也会因格式不正确的区域引用显示#NAME?错误。例如输入C2C11而非`C2:C11(缺少冒号)会使Excel无法识别。
建议手动操作时用鼠标选取区域来避免此类拼写错误。

文本缺少引号
在公式中使用文本字符串时,必须用直双引号包裹(如"苹果")。若忘记引号,Excel会默认将其视为函数或命名区域。若找不到匹配项,就会产生#NAME?错误。
例如:
- 正确写法:
=IF(A1="苹果", "是", "否") - 错误写法:
=IF(A1=苹果, 是, 否)
同时注意从网站或Word文档复制的"智能引号"(如“或”),它们在Excel公式中无效。

针对引用和文本错误的AI替代方案
使用匡优Excel等工具可消除不正确区域引用和缺失引号等语法错误。通过描述目标——"如果A列值为'苹果',就在B列显示'是',否则显示'否'"——AI会自动处理正确语法,包括区域冒号和文本引号。
缺少加载项或自定义函数
某些函数需要启用特定加载项。例如EUROCONVERT()仅在欧元货币工具加载项激活时有效。若未启用则会显示#NAME?错误。同样适用于特定工作簿中通过VBA创建的自定义函数。

若在不存在代码的工作簿中使用自定义VBA函数(如=GetInitials(A1)),Excel将无法识别。

如何修复Excel中的#NAME?错误
了解成因后,让我们探讨解决方案。
传统方法:手动调试
修复单个#NAME?错误需要仔细检查。
- 使用自动完成:输入公式时Excel会提示函数,按
Tab键插入正确函数避免拼写错误 - 检查名称管理器:使用命名区域时,通过公式 > 名称管理器验证拼写和范围
- 修正引号:确保公式中所有文本都用
"直双引号"包裹 - 用鼠标选取区域:用鼠标选择区域而非手动输入,防止
C2C11类错误 - 验证Excel版本:确保所用函数受当前Excel版本支持
- 启用加载项:通过文件 > 选项 > 加载项启用所需加载项
- 刷新公式:按
F9强制重新计算整个工作簿
查找并修复工作簿中所有#NAME?错误
若工作表充满错误,可通过两种方式全面查找:
使用"定位条件"
- 进入开始 > 查找和选择 > 定位条件(或按
F5后点击特殊...) - 选择公式并仅勾选错误复选框
- 点击确定,Excel将高亮显示所有含公式错误的单元格

使用查找替换
- 按
Ctrl + F打开查找对话框 - 在"查找内容"框中输入
#NAME? - 点击查找全部查看所有含该错误的单元格列表

AI驱动方法:跳过调试直接获取答案
无需逐个查找修复#NAME?错误,您可以通过AI代理采用更直接的途径。

使用匡优Excel的过程截然不同:您无需修复损坏的公式,只需告诉AI您最初想要实现的目标。
- 上传电子表格至匡优Excel

- 用自然语言陈述原始目标。例如不修复损坏的
=SUMMIF(A1:A50, "销售", B1:B50),而是直接询问"A列为'销售'时B列的总和是多少?"
- 立即获取正确结果。匡优Excel分析原始数据并计算结果,忽略工作表中现有错误。

这种方法将焦点从调试过程(修复公式)转向实现结果(获取正确数值)。
如何预防#NAME?错误
最佳应对策略是防患于未然。
传统方式:使用公式向导
若不确定如何编写公式,Excel的公式向导可提供指导。点击编辑栏旁的fx按钮打开向导,搜索函数并根据Excel提示填写参数。

AI方式:使用自然语言
终极预防工具无需编写公式。使用匡优Excel等AI代理时,您的指令就是公式。通过用自然语言提问,可在语法错误、拼写错误和版本问题发生前就将其消除。这如同有位专家在身边,将您的问题转化为准确结果。
额外提示与最佳实践
养成良好习惯可避免再次遇到#NAME?错误:
不要隐藏错误:修复它
IFERROR()等函数可通过显示自定义消息隐藏错误,但并未解决根本问题。错误计算仍然存在,只是被隐藏。务必优先修复根本原因。
关注命名区域
在大型或共享工作簿中,命名区域可能被意外删除或更改。定期检查名称管理器确保一切正常。
总结
以上就是关于Excel中#NAME?错误的全面解析。虽然看似令人畏惧,但通常只需纠正拼写错误、缺失引号或损坏引用等简单错误。通过掌握排查方法,您可以用耐心手动修复这些问题。
但正如我们所见,现代AI工具提供了根本性不同且通常更高效的工作流程。您无需深陷公式语法和调试工作,通过匡优Excel等AI代理专注于提出问题,让技术处理执行环节。这不仅预防#NAME?错误,更加速整个数据分析流程。
准备跳过错误直接获取答案? 立即试用匡优Excel,改变您的数据处理方式。只需上传电子表格、提出问题、获取结果——无需编写公式。
Excel函数名区分大小写吗?
不区分。输入sum()或SUM()效果相同,但拼写必须完全正确。
受保护工作表或锁定单元格会导致#NAME?错误吗?
不会直接导致,但若无法编辑公式单元格则会阻碍错误修复。